Output 1f42370008d31dfce42f7f9d52b3e629a605e7a22cbaf695b363752c98e76a5d:0

value
3952884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a7284fc0ebceefaa9935306535ee2d6e4b6001 OP_EQUAL
address
3DRGfQJ943y79s2ZTpcPFYj4rFonqJqbdM
transaction
1f42370008d31dfce42f7f9d52b3e629a605e7a22cbaf695b363752c98e76a5d
spent
true